What is Self-Storage?

Self-storage is a service where you can rent a storage unit to keep your belongings. These units come in different sizes, allowing you to store anything from a few boxes to the contents of an entire house.

Key Features of Self-Storage:
  1. Accessibility: You can access your items whenever you need during the facility’s operating hours.
  2. Variety of Sizes: There are different unit sizes to match your storage needs.
  3. Cost-Effective: It’s usually cheaper than full-service storage because you handle everything yourself.
  4. Security: Many facilities have good security, but it varies, so it’s important to choose a reputable one.
  5. DIY Approach: You’re responsible for packing, transporting, and organizing your belongings, giving you more control but requiring more effort.
What is Full-Service Storage?

Full-service storage is a more hands-off option where the company takes care of everything, from picking up your items to storing and delivering them back to you.

Key Features of Full-Service Storage:
  1. Convenience: The company handles everything, saving you time and effort.
  2. Inventory Management: You can track your stored items online, making it easy to request specific items for delivery.
  3. Professional Packing: Some companies offer packing services to ensure your items are safely stored.
  4. Higher Cost: This convenience comes at a higher price.
  5. Limited Access: You need to schedule deliveries in advance, so it’s not as flexible as self-storage.
Comparing Self-Storage and Full-Service Storage
  1. Accessibility: Self-storage offers direct access, while full-service storage requires scheduling.
  2. Cost: Self-storage is generally cheaper; full-service storage is more expensive due to added services.
  3. Convenience: Self-storage requires more effort from you; full-service storage is hassle-free.
  4. Security: Both can be secure, but full-service storage often includes professional handling.
  5. Flexibility: Self-storage lets you access and arrange your items as needed; full-service storage offers less flexibility.
When to Choose Self-Storage?

Self-storage is ideal if you need frequent access to your items, are on a budget, want control over how your items are stored, and are comfortable with doing the work yourself.

When to Choose Full-Service Storage?

Full-service storage is better if you value convenience, have limited time, need professional packing for valuable or fragile items, or require help with heavy or bulky items.

Hybrid Solutions

Some companies offer hybrid options, combining self-storage with full-service features like pickup and delivery, giving you a balance of convenience and control.
